Mortgage Rates Are Up - Check Your Numbers

Tyler Hodgson
  • Investor
  • Lewisville, TX
Posted

If you're in the market to purchase right now (investment property or primary residence), you may want to get an updated interest rate quote from your mortgage broker. In the last couple of weeks rates have JUMPED over 0.50%. The average is now up to 3.75% on a Conventional primary residence (Source: Mortgage News Daily). 

So if you were running numbers based on rate quotes you got in December or before, you'll want to update those calculations! This could limit you buyer power also, if your debt-to-income ratio was near the max at a lower interest rate.
